Principle or equation
For a standard normal distribution, P(a < Z < b) = Φ(b) - Φ(a), where Φ is the cumulative distribution function.
Why this answer is correct
Using standard normal table: Φ(0.5) ≈ 0.6915, Φ(-1.5) ≈ 0.0668. Probability = 0.6915 - 0.0668 = 0.6247.
Example
P(-1 < Z < 1) ≈ 0.8413 - 0.1587 = 0.6826.
